See how your contributions will help transform vision into reality: Position Overview: Navico Group, the global leader in marine electronics and a division of Brunswick Corporation, is seeking a Digital Marketing Manager to drive the performance of assigned brand websites and digital experiences within a portfolio of brand sites. This role is accountable for translating business priorities into actionable digital plans, building and managing digital roadmaps for assigned brands, and converting analytics into insights and recommended actions that improve lead generation, product discovery, dealer engagement, and conversion outcomes. The Digital Marketing Manager sits within Navico Group's dedicated division-level digital team and coordinates daily with Brunswick's enterprise-level Centers of Excellence (COEs) that own paid media, SEO, marketing automation, analytics, and development, as well as the division's Web Operations function responsible for CMS publishing and quality assurance. This is a digital performance and experience role: the Digital Marketing Manager orchestrates work across these partners and is accountable for the digital outcomes of assigned properties rather than owning channel campaign execution or content production. At the same time, this is a lean team - a willingness to work hands-on and move work forward directly is essential. This role operates within the digital strategy, standards, and prioritization framework established by the Director of Digital Marketing, and plays an active part in modernizing how digital work is planned, prioritized, measured, and optimized - including AI-enabled workflows, automation, scalable content operations, and reusable digital patterns. Under the direction and supervision of the Regional Business Director, the Business Development Manager (BDM) will manage and grow the Mercury Marine Independent Boatbuilder network within his/her assigned OEM sales territory through strategic relationship development with current and prospective customers. In addition to regional OEM responsibilities, this role will lead Mercury Racing sales efforts across the United States. The successful BDM will coach, consult, develop, and grow sales volume, market share, and profitability across both OEM and Racing product lines. The selected candidate will reside within the defined OEM territory of responsibility. The OEM territory spans the Southeast and Gulf Coast regions of the United States. About Mercury: Headquartered in Fond du Lac, Wisconsin, Mercury Marine is the world's leading manufacturer of recreational marine propulsion engines. A division of Brunswick Corporation (NYSE: BC), Mercury provides engines, boats, services and parts for recreational, commercial and government marine applications. Mercury empowers boaters with products that are easy to use, extremely reliable and backed by the most dedicated customer support in the world. The company's industry-leading brand portfolio includes Mercury outboard engines, Mercury MerCruiser sterndrive and inboard packages, Mercury propellers, Mercury inflatable boats, Mercury SmartCraft electronics, Land 'N' Sea marine parts distribution and Mercury and Quicksilver parts and oils.
